Classic MGs

Don Martine - MG

Don Martine has been interested in cars since he was three years of age. A picture of him with a grease gun, attempting to lubricate his pedal car (age three) is in the display area at his Martine Inn - An elegant Bed & Breakfast that overlooks the magnificent Monterey Bay.

Don's interest in MGs began in 1950 when his father, Homer Martine, purchased a 1949 MGTC. This interest was furthered when he watched Johnny Von Neumann drive his 1950 MGTD Special to victory at the inaugural Pebble Beach Road Races, a car that Don now owns and has on display.

The MG display area contains watercolors by Sandra Leitzinger, oil paintings by Peter Hearsey, posters, prints, photos, tools, signs, gas pumps, historic helmets, paraphernalia and checkered flag black and white-tiled floor.

Don has a restoration shop near the inn where he restores these cars and builds the race engines for the race cars. Some of the cars that may be on display include the following cars.

  • 1932 MG D: four-seater, 850 cc, 4-cylinder,overhead cam, three-speed transmission. 208 made. This car is currently being restored and pictures of the restoration are available at Don's Martine Inn Motorsports.
  • 1933 MG L2 Roadster: 1,087 cc, six-cylinder, overhead cam, four-speed transmission. 85 made.
  • 1936 MG, NB Magnette Special Roadster: six-cylinder overhead cam, 1.5 litre, supercharged, Wilson preselector trans, airplane hydraulic front brakes, west coast racer. One only.
  • 1948 MG TC: supercharged, four-cylinder push rod, 1.5 litre, four-speed transmission, dunlop 16-inch racing wheels, Alfin drum brakes. 10,000 made.
  • 1949 MG Y Sedan: four-cylinder, pushrod, 1.25 litre, four-speed trans, hydraulic brakes, factory sunroof, wind out windshield, roll up rear window shade, built-in jacks. 6,000 made.
  • 1949 MG TC Roadster: four-cylinder, pushrod, 1.25 litre, four-speed transmission, absolutely original. 10,000 made.
  • 1950 MG TD Von Neumann Special Roadster: four-cylinder, pushrod, 1.5 litre, TC trans, Alfin drum brakes, Borranni wire wheels, aluminum body by Emil Deidt, most winning west coast racer in 1950-51. One only.
  • 1951 Daimler Empress Sports Sedan: body by Hooper, 2.5 litre, pushrod, six-cylinder, Wilson preselector transmission. 90 made.
  • 1953 MG TD, MK II, Roadster: four-cylinder pushrod, 1.25 litre, larger carbs, larger valves, two fuel pumps, eight shocks, higher compression factory competition TD. 1,700 made.
  • 1955 MG TF 1500 Convertible Pickup: four-cylinder pushrod, 1.5 litre, chassis stretched 1 ft., pick up box added, made by Jack Anderson to house his wheelchair. One only.
  • 1960 MG A Roadster: 1.622 liter, four-cylinder, pushrod, four-speed transmission, disc brakes, 100 mph car. 31,501 made.
  • 1963 MG 1300 Sedan: 1275 cc, pushrod, four-cylinder, transverse engine, front wheel drive, factory race car. 1 only.
  • 1967 MG B Roadster: 1789 cc, four-cylinder, pushrod, four-speed transmission, plus overdrive. 15,128 made.
